日期:2014-05-18  浏览次数:20351 次

数据表有个字段Up是Boolean类型,sql后面where条件要等于false,如何写?
"Select   *   FROM   Company   order   by   UpdateTime   WHERE   Up=false "

这样写错了。。要怎么写?

------解决方案--------------------
Accesss

"Select * FROM Company WHERE Up=true order by UpdateTime "
"Select * FROM Company WHERE Up=false order by UpdateTime "


SQL Server 通常选择 bit 类型,对应 .net 中类型 即 Boolean,但 sql 语句使用 1 和 0

"Select * FROM Company WHERE Up=1 order by UpdateTime "
"Select * FROM Company WHERE Up=0 order by UpdateTime "


------解决方案--------------------
jf,肯承认错误的是好孩子~~
------解决方案--------------------
SQL 用01
ACCESS才用ture false